MnP3 is a next-generation, brain-penetrant manganese porphyrin-based superoxide dismutase (SOD) mimic. It is designed to protect normal brain tissue from radiation-induced damage by scavenging deleterious free radicals generated during radiotherapy. Unlike earlier SOD mimics, MnP3 is specifically engineered for enhanced blood-brain barrier (BBB) penetration and a favorable safety profile. Preclinical studies have demonstrated its ability to accumulate in the brain and significantly reduce radiation-induced DNA damage, lipid peroxidation, apoptosis, and microglia activation, potentially preventing long-term cognitive deficits associated with brain irradiation.
